BASIC POLENTA



Basic Polenta image

Dinner is easy with Giada De Laurentiis' Basic Polenta recipe from Everyday Italian on Food Network; it's the perfect cornmeal canvas for your favorite mains.

Provided by Giada De Laurentiis

Categories     side-dish

Time 30m

Yield 6 servings

Number Of Ingredients 4

6 cups water
2 teaspoons salt
1 3/4 cups yellow cornmeal
3 tablespoons unsalted butter

Steps:

  • Bring 6 cups of water to a boil in a heavy large saucepan. Add 2 teaspoons of salt. Gradually whisk in the cornmeal. Reduce the heat to low and cook until the mixture thickens and the cornmeal is tender, stirring often, about 15 minutes. Turn off the heat. Add the butter, and stir until melted.

POLENTA PARTY!



Polenta Party! image

Provided by Cat Cora

Categories     side-dish

Time 3h35m

Yield 6 to 8 servings

Number Of Ingredients 8

1/2 cup polenta, medium grind
1/2 cup semolina flour
2 cups chicken stock
2 cups cream
1/8 teaspoon freshly grated nutmeg
3/4 teaspoon salt
1/4 cup grated Fontina
1/4 cup grated Parmesan

Steps:

  • In a small bowl combine the polenta and semolina and set aside.
  • In a heavy stainless pan or casserole, Combine the stock, cream, nutmeg, and salt and place over medium heat. Bring mixture to a simmer, and slowly but steadily whisk in the polenta and semolina.
  • Continue to stir, allowing the mixture to return to a simmer and then reduce the heat so that the mixture barely bubbles. Stir the polenta for about 5 more minutes, until it thickens and begins to pull away from the sides of the pot. Remove the pot from the heat. Sprinkle the grated cheese over the hot polenta and mix well.
  • While the polenta is warm spread it evenly in an ungreased 8 by 8-inch square pan. Allow the polenta to cool for about 10 minutes and then cover it with plastic wrap. Refrigerate 2 to 3 hours or overnight.
  • After the polenta has thoroughly chilled, loosen the sides of the polenta by running a knife around the sides of the pan. Cut into 2 inch squares or as desired. Lift the pieces out carefully with a small spatula and place on a small sheet pan. Grill or broil the polenta pieces until they are golden brown. Serve with a variety of toppings such as Parmesan, bolognese, balsamic mushrooms and broccoli rabe with crushed chili flakes.

SOFT POLENTA



Soft Polenta image

Provided by Michael Symon : Food Network

Categories     side-dish

Time 55m

Yield 4 servings

Number Of Ingredients 5

Kosher salt and freshly ground black pepper
1/4 cup extra-virgin olive oil
1 cup yellow cornmeal or polenta
4 tablespoons unsalted butter
1/4 cup freshly grated Parmesan

Steps:

  • Add 4 1/2 cups water, 1 tablespoon salt and the olive oil to a medium saucepot and bring to a simmer over medium heat. Whisk in the cornmeal in a steady stream, until it is all incorporated and smooth.
  • Reduce the heat to medium low and continue to cook at a simmer until the polenta is creamy and fully hydrated, 30 to 40 minutes.
  • Take the saucepot off the heat and whisk in the butter and Parmesan. Season with additional salt and pepper. Transfer the polenta to a large serving bowl and serve.

POLENTA



Polenta image

Simple directions on how to cook plain polenta. There are many options for polenta once it is cooked: you can mix in fresh herbs and cheeses, bake it, or fry it! Experiment and choose your favorite technique!

Provided by IDAJ

Categories     Side Dish     Grain Side Dish Recipes     Polenta Recipes

Time 25m

Yield 4

Number Of Ingredients 2

3 cups water
1 cup polenta

Steps:

  • Bring water to a boil. Reduce to a simmer. Pour in polenta steadily, stirring constantly. Continue to stir until polenta is thickened. It should come away from sides of the pan, and be able to support a spoon. This can take anywhere from 20 to 50 minutes. Pour polenta onto a wooden cutting board, let stand for a few minutes.
